Why Local News Anchors Matter
Local news anchors play a crucial role in our communities. They do more than just read headlines; they connect us, inform us, and guide us through important events. Here’s why they matter:
Community Connection
Local news anchors are often deeply embedded in the community. They attend local events, support local charities, and understand the unique issues facing the area. This connection allows them to report on stories that matter most to the community, fostering a sense of unity and shared identity.
Informative Reporting
They provide essential information about local events, politics, and issues that directly affect residents. This helps people make informed decisions and participate actively in their communities. By staying informed, citizens can contribute to the well-being and progress of their neighborhoods.
Trust and Reliability
In an era of misinformation, local news anchors provide a trusted source of information. They adhere to journalistic standards of accuracy and fairness, ensuring that viewers receive reliable news. This trust is essential for maintaining a healthy democracy and informed citizenry.
Guiding During Crises
During emergencies, local news anchors become vital sources of information and guidance. They provide updates on weather events, public health crises, and other emergencies, helping people stay safe and informed. Their calm and reassuring presence can help ease anxiety and provide a sense of stability during uncertain times.
